Black Country Knowledge is home to a wide range of times series data sets, which we regular maintain and update. These indicators form part of the Black Country Performance Management Framework which enables us to understand if we are making real progress towards achievement of our Black Country aspirations as set out in the Black Country Vision and the ‘Black Country Strategy for Growth and Competitiveness’.

We analyse this data and add information to it to transform it into intelligence. With this intelligence we produce easy to read regular and timely reports which we call the Black Country Barometers. These reports provide clear analysis of recent data and enables debate to be evidence driven. The barometer reports are produced on a themed basis:

  • Business Barometer: providing information on the New Business Statistics – covering the new national indicators - Business Registration rate (NI 171) and Small Businesses showing Employment Growth (NI 172). The report also provides information on business survival rates, employment and wage data.

  • Place Barometer: focusing on the ‘place indicators’ in the Black Country Performance Management Framework including employment land and housing and results of the recent Place survey.

  • People Barometer: focusing on education and skills data

  • State of the Sub-Region - an annual report which enables us to clearly evaluate the impact of the Black Country regeneration strategies on the sub-region in the context of the Black Country Performance Management Framework

    Other reports include:

  • Black Country Recession Intelligence - a bi monthly bulletin which provides real time evidence to stimulate evidence based policy debate and ensure that the Black Country voice is heard across the sub-region and in regional and national forums.

  • Black Country Strategic Companies - an analysis of the key strategic companies in the Black Country.
